    Just keep him well fed and the tail will be back in no time at all. I got a leo without a tail for a really good price and I just fed him lots of crickets and waxworms 1-2 times a week to put some weight back on. He is a cutie but my only concern is that he may have trouble catching his food in the cage. It looks pretty well decorated with lots of places for crickets to hide. Just my $.02
